Programs like Business Oregon's Rural Opportunity Initiative and the Shop Harney digital gift card program demonstrate how investing in entrepreneurs and the ecosystems around them drives long-term stability and prosperity for rural communities. The Rural Visibility Project is a policy advocacy campaign designed to center rural priorities through community-driven dialogue and elevate rural voices in state-level policy conversations. Our focus is on priority topics to impact specific policies and legislation that will move through the Oregon State Capitol during the short session in 2026, with the hopes of creating our own rurally inclusive policies for the 2027 session. We're excited to see you for the conference, held April 16 and 17 in Bend, OR, with two days of networking opportunities, keynotes, breakout sessions interpreted or offered in English and Spanish, plus optional mobile workshops and pre-sessions on April 15. Thursday's keynote speaker, Amanda Weinstein, Director of Research, Knowledge, & Evaluation at the Center on Rural Innovation (CORI), will speak to the state of rural, with a focus on the picture for the rural West. Breakout session topics include community leadership and engagement, economic vitality and wealth building, policy and influence, and access to resources.
